Q: Is it possible to run my brokerage from my home? 

A: Under Section 61J2-10.022, Florida Administrative Code, the required office can be in a residential location as long as it doesn’t violate local zoning ordinances. However, minimum office requirements and brokers’ signage requirements must still be met. If this type of office interests you, be certain to check with any homeowners’ association or condominium association. It’s possible that these associations prohibit such businesses.
